Head-to-Head Match with the Black Organization: A Dual Mystery on a Full Moon Night (黒の組織と真っ向勝負満月の夜の二元ミステリー Kuro no Soshiki to Makkō Shōbu Mangetsu no Yoru no Nigen Misuterī) is the 345th episode of Detective Conan anime. Adapted from files 429-434 in volume 42, it is the first two-and-a-half-hour special to be aired, split in five thirty-minute segments. It was storyboarded by Yasuichiro Yamamoto and Chika Ichimaru, and animated by Keiko Sasaki, Rei Masunaga, Atsushi Aono, Akiko Kawashima and Katsunori Enomoto. It is one of the most important episodes of the series, being the culmination of the Vermouth Arc. Taking place at a mysterious off-season halloween party on a pirate ship in Tokyo Bay where the event organizer is killed, it shows a confrontation between Conan and Vermouth, the latter knowing Conan's real identity as Shinichi Kudo and planning for him to arrive at the event so the Black Organization can corner him. However, Conan has prepared a cunning plan to take down Vermouth, as she is also targeting Ai Haibara, the runaway scientist from the Organization. The case's conclusion results with Conan's discovery of the Boss's cellphone number. It is regarded by many fans as one of the best episodes of the series, due to its contrived plot surrounding Conan's plan to take down Vermouth and for the major revelations that will be important later on in the series. Beautiful Fins (美しい鰭 Utsukushii Hire) is a song by rock band Spitz that was released on April 10, 2023 as digital single and on April 12, 2023 as CD single. The song is featured as the ending theme for the 26th movie, Black Iron Submarine. With Masamune Kusano as voice and guitar, Tetsuya Miwa as second guitar, Akihiro Tamura as bass and Tatsuo Sakiyama as drums, it was written and composed by Kusano and arranged by the band and Seiji Kameda as their 46th single. The digital single peaked at 3rd position on the weekly Oricon Chart, while the regular version peaked at 4th.

Did you know...
- ... Mai Kuraki holds the Guinness World Record for "most theme songs sung by the same artist for an animation series"?
- ... Paikaru was used as the main ingredient for the antidote prototype to APTX 4869?
- ... The first case Kogoro solves by himself is Kogoro's Class Reunion Murder Case?
- ... Kogoro Mouri was mistaken with an astronaut in episode 57 because there's a Japanese astronaut named Mamoru Mouri?

- A collaboration between Detective Conan and Star Detective PreCure! has been announced. Conan, Kogoro, and Ran will appear in Star Detective PreCure! Episode 18 airing on May 31, 2026, while Anna Akechi/Cure Answer will appear in Detective Conan Episode 1203 airing on June 6, 2026.
- Wakana Yamazaki, who voiced Ran Mouri since the start of the Detective Conan anime to January 2026, passes away at the age of 61. Akemi Okamura continues as the permanent, new voice of Ran Mouri.
- Movie 30 of Detective Conan will feature Shinichi Kudo and Ran Mouri and is likely related to the Holmes' Revelation case.
- The domestic box office revenue for the 29th movie of Detective Conan, Fallen Angel of the Highway has surpassed 10 billion yen within a month of its release on April 10, 2026.
- Since March 14, 2026, Akemi Okamura has temporarily replaced Wakana Yamazaki as the voice of Ran Mouri due to Wakana's hiatus to take care of her health.
- 3 special episodes have been announced as part of a project commemorating the 30th anniversary of the anime. They include a collaborative episode with Japan International Birdman Rally written by Takahiro Okura, a J-League collaboration episode, and a 2-hour special episode Murder Case No. 30 written by Takeharu Sakurai.
- A new English dub of Detective Conan with selected episodes, including some never shown in the U.S. before, has been released on Crunchyroll and Netflix. The latest selection is titled Rivals of the Great Detective.
- The latest Detective Conan planetarium special movie, titled The Shining Payload, premiered on March 8, 2025. Screenplay by Akatsuki Yamatoya and direction by Hiroaki Takagi; it is currently screening in some planetariums in Japan.
